Understanding the ideal timing to use heat and ice for recovery is vital. After intense strength training, heat can be beneficial for sore muscles that require a little tenderness and relaxation. Applying heat for around 15-20 minutes can often lead to an enhanced muscle relaxation response. During this process, be aware of the temperature of the heat source. To avoid burns or discomfort, ensure the heat isn’t too intense, as skin reactions can disrupt the cool-down process. Immediately following exercise and for the initial 24 hours, ice is the primary choice. It’s crucial to apply it in intervals, typically around 10 to 15 minutes at a time. This method helps your body respond better to stress by controlling swelling. Following the first day, heat therapy significantly aids in the recovery and restoration of muscle tissue. In addition to heat and ice application, stretching plays a fundamental role in the recovery process. Incorporating gentle stretches after heat therapy can enhance flexibility. Effective flexibility aids muscle recovery, reducing stiffness while promoting relaxation. Choose stretches that target the areas you’ve been training most intensely, as they’ll benefit significantly. For example, perform light static stretches focused on the hips, legs, and back. However, avoid bouncing or vigorous movements during these stretches, as they may lead to injury. Instead, hold each position steadily for around 20 to 30 seconds, allowing your muscles to gradually lengthen and relax. On the other hand, while utilizing ice therapy, perform passive stretches to compliment the cold application. This helps maintain range of motion while preventing excessive tightening of the muscles after ice treatment. The Benefits of Heat Therapy

Heat therapy’s benefits are abundant, promoting optimal muscle recovery after strength training sessions. Using heat dilates blood vessels, improving circulation and flow effectively. This enhanced blood flow translates to a direct supply of oxygen and nutrients necessary for muscle repair. Additionally, heat application can also alleviate muscle stiffness. This is crucial after heavy workouts, as stiffness can limit movement and even contribute to injury. As muscles relax under heat treatment, they regain elasticity, making them more responsive during physical activity. Furthermore, heat aids in the release of endorphins, natural pain relievers that contribute to a sense of well-being. However, it’s recommended to limit heat exposure to reasonable periods, typically 15-20 minutes. Failing to do so may lead to overheating, resulting in an adverse effect on recovery. Conversely, ice therapy also plays a crucial role in post-training recovery. Applying ice alleviates soreness, reducing muscle and joint inflammation that often occurs post-exercise. The benefits provided by ice therapy in the recovery stage are invaluable, especially after vigorous strength training sessions. Ice acts as a local anesthetic, numbing pain during and after recovery. Research indicates that ice therapy reduces muscle damage and is essential in speedily restoring function to worn-out muscles. However, it’s significant to note the ideal time frame for applying ice effectively. Generally, ice should be used within the first 24 hours of post-exercise recovery. After this, switching back to heat has its merits as muscle restoration continues. The application of ice should also be brief, usually consistent with 15-20 minute intervals to allow for skin recovery. Furthermore, to optimize its effectiveness, consider incorporating elevation alongside ice application. This reduces swelling even further, ensuring you can recover more efficiently.
